INTRODUCTION
Diverticula (mucosal outpouching through the wall of the colon) affect over 5% of adults aged 40 years and older, but only 10-25% of affected people will develop symptoms such as lower abdominal pain. Recurrent symptoms are common, and 5% of people with diverticula eventually develop complications such as perforation, obstruction, haemorrhage, fistulae, or abscesses.

OBJECTIVE
To understand why the population-based incidence of diverticulitis has increased over time, we studied temporal changes in age, body mass index (BMI), and diverticulitis in Olmsted County, Minnesota.
PARTICIPANTS AND METHODS
We compared the BMIs of 2967 patients with diverticulitis and 9795 people without diverticulitis from January 1, 1980, through December 31, 2007. Because BMI is a surrogate for adipose tissue, computed tomographic estimations of abdominal fat content were compared between 381 diverticulitis cases and 381 age- and sex-matched controls.
RESULTS
Between 1980 and 2007, the prevalence of obesity increased from 12% to 49% in the population and from 19% to 40% in patients with diverticulitis (P<.001 for both). Temporal trends in age, BMI, and the increased incidence of diverticulitis in people with normal BMI accounted for 48%, 47%, and 20%, respectively, of corresponding trends in diverticulitis. The secular decline in the proportion of people with normal BMI was partly offset by an increased incidence of diverticulitis in such people. In the case-control study, BMI was greater in cases than in controls (P=.001). However, after incorporating abdominal visceral (odds ratio [OR], 2.4; 95% CI, 1.6-3.7) and subcutaneous (OR, 2.9; 95% CI, 1.7-5.2) fat content (both associated with diverticulitis), BMI was associated with lower risk (OR, 0.8; 95% CI, 0.7-0.8) of diverticulitis.
CONCLUSION
Aging, increasing obesity, and the increased incidence of diverticulitis in people with normal BMI account for the temporal increase in diverticulitis. Rather than BMI per se, increased abdominal visceral and subcutaneous fat are independently associated with diverticulitis. The incidence of diverticulitis, which is among the most common gastrointestinal diagnoses in hospitalized patients, has increased markedly since 2000. This study suggests that aging, increasing obesity, and the increased incidence of diverticulitis in people with normal BMI account for the temporal increase in diverticulitis.

BACKGROUND
Use of antibiotics in selected cases of acute uncomplicated diverticulitis (AUD) has recently been questioned.
OBJECTIVE
The aim of this study is to examine the safety and efficacy of treatment regimens without antibiotics compared with that of traditional treatments with antibiotics in selected patients with AUD.
DATA SOURCES
PubMed, Medline, Embase, Web of Science, and the Cochrane Library.
METHODS
A systematic review was performed according to PRISMA and AMSTAR guidelines by searching through Medline, Embase, Web of Science, and the Cochrane Library for randomized clinical trials (RCTs) published before December 2022. The outcomes assessed were the rates of readmission, change in strategy, emergency surgery, worsening, and persistent diverticulitis.
STUDY SELECTION
RCTs on treating AUD without antibiotics published in English before December 2022 were included.
INTERVENTION
Treatments without antibiotics were compared with treatments with antibiotics.
MAIN OUTCOME MEASURES
The outcomes assessed were the rates of readmission, change in strategy, emergency surgery, worsening, and persistent diverticulitis.
RESULTS
The search yielded 1163 studies. Four RCTs with 1809 patients were included in the review. Among these patients, 50.1% were treated conservatively without antibiotics. The meta-analysis showed no significant differences between nonantibiotic and antibiotic treatment groups with respect to rates of readmission [odds ratio (OR)=1.39; 95% CI: 0.93-2.06; P =0.11; I2 =0%], change in strategy (OR=1.03; 95% CI: 0.52-2,02; P =0.94; I2 =44%), emergency surgery (OR=0.43; 95% CI: 0.12-1.53; P =0.19; I2 =0%), worsening (OR=0.91; 95% CI: 0.48-1.73; P =0.78; I2 =0%), and persistent diverticulitis (OR=1.54; 95% CI: 0.63-3.26; P =0.26; I2 =0%).
LIMITATIONS
Heterogeneity and a limited number of RCTs.
CONCLUSIONS
Treatment for AUD without antibiotic therapy is safe and effective in selected patients. Further RTCs should confirm the present findings.

This study aimed to investigate the estimated rate and risk of recurrence of uncomplicated diverticulitis (UCD) after the first episode through a meta-analysis. Eligible studies were searched and reviewed; 27 studies were included in this study. Subgroup analyses were performed, based on lesion location, medical treatment, follow-up period, and study location. The estimated recurrence rate of UCD was 0.129 (95% confidence interval [CI] 0.102-0.162). The recurrence rates of the right-and left-sided colon were 0.092 (95% CI 27.063-0.133) and 0.153 (95% CI 0.104-0.218), respectively. The recurrence rate according to follow-up period was highest in the subgroup 1-2 years, compared with that of other subgroups. The recurrence rate of the Asian subgroup was significantly lower than that of the non-Asian subgroup (0.092, 95% CI 0.064-0.132 vs. 0.147, 95% CI 0.110-0.192; = 0.043 in the meta-regression test). There were significant correlations between UCD recurrence and older age and higher body temperature. However, UCD recurrence was not significantly correlated with medications, such as antibiotics or anti-inflammatory drugs. In this study, detailed information on estimated recurrence rates of UCD was obtained. In addition, older age and higher body temperature may be risk factors for UCD recurrence after the first episode.

BACKGROUND
Diverticular disease can undermine health-related quality of life. The diverticulitis quality of life (DV-QOL) instrument was designed and validated to measure patient-reported burden of diverticular disease. However, values reflecting meaningful improvement (i.e., minimal clinically important difference [MCID]) and the patient acceptable symptom state (PASS) have yet to be established. We sought to establish the MCID and PASS of the DV-QOL and describe the characteristics of those with DV-QOL above the PASS threshold.
MATERIALS AND METHODS
We performed a prospective cohort study of adults with diverticular disease from seven centers in Washington and California (2016-2018). Patients were surveyed at baseline, then quarterly up to 30 mo. To determine the MCID and PASS for DV-QOL, we applied various previously established distribution- and anchor-based approaches and compared the resulting values.
RESULTS
The study included 177 patients (mean age 57 y, 43% women). A PASS threshold of 3.2/10 distinguished between those with and without health-related quality of life-impacting diverticulitis with acceptable accuracy (area under the curve 0.76). A change of 2.2 points in the DV-QOL was the most appropriate MCID: above the distribution-based MCIDs and corresponding to patient perception of importance of change (AUC 0.70). Patients with DV-QOL ≥ PASS were more often men, younger, had Medicaid, had more serious episodes of diverticulitis, and had an occupational degree or high-school education or less.
CONCLUSIONS
Our study is the first to define MCID and PASS for DV-QOL. These thresholds are critical for measuring the impact of diverticular disease and the evaluation of treatment effectiveness.

BACKGROUND
In the last two decades, there has been a Copernican revolution in the decision-making for the treatment of Diverticular Disease.
PURPOSE
This article provides a report on the state-of-the-art of surgery for sigmoid diverticulitis.
CONCLUSION
Acute diverticulitis is the most common reason for colonic resection after cancer; in the last decade, the indication for surgical resection has become more and more infrequent also in emergency. Currently, emergency surgery is seldom indicated, mostly for severe abdominal infective complications. Nowadays, uncomplicated diverticulitis is the most frequent presentation of diverticular disease and it is usually approached with a conservative medical treatment. Non-Operative Management may be considered also for complicated diverticulitis with abdominal abscess. At present, there is consensus among experts that the hemodynamic response to the initial fluid resuscitation should guide the emergency surgical approach to patients with severe sepsis or septic shock. In hemodynamically stable patients, a laparoscopic approach is the first choice, and surgeons with advanced laparoscopic skills report advantages in terms of lower postoperative complication rates. At the moment, the so-called Hartmann's procedure is only indicated in severe generalized peritonitis with metabolic derangement or in severely ill patients. Some authors suggested laparoscopic peritoneal lavage as a bridge to surgery or also as a definitive treatment without colonic resection in selected patients. In case of hemodynamic instability not responding to fluid resuscitation, an initial damage control surgery seems to be more attractive than a Hartmann's procedure, and it is associated with a high rate of primary anastomosis.

BACKGROUND
The incidence of acute left-sided colonic diverticulitis (ACD) is increasing in the Western world. To improve the quality of patient care, a guideline for diagnosis and treatment of diverticulitis is needed.
METHODS
A multidisciplinary working group, representing experts of relevant specialties, was involved in the guideline development. A systematic literature search was conducted to collect scientific evidence on epidemiology, classification, diagnostics and treatment of diverticulitis. Literature was assessed using the classification system according to an evidence-based guideline development method, and levels of evidence of the conclusions were assigned to each topic. Final recommendations were given, taking into account the level of evidence of the conclusions and other relevant considerations such as patient preferences, costs and availability of facilities.
RESULTS
The natural history of diverticulitis is usually mild and treatment is mostly conservative. Although younger patients have a higher risk of recurrent disease, a higher risk of complications compared to older patients was not found. In general, the clinical diagnosis of ACD is not accurate enough and therefore imaging is indicated. The triad of pain in the lower left abdomen on physical examination, the absence of vomiting and a C-reactive protein >50 mg/l has a high predictive value to diagnose ACD. If this triad is present and there are no signs of complicated disease, patients may be withheld from further imaging. If imaging is indicated, conditional computed tomography, only after a negative or inconclusive ultrasound, gives the best results. There is no indication for routine endoscopic examination after an episode of diverticulitis. There is no evidence for the routine administration of antibiotics in patients with clinically mild uncomplicated diverticulitis. Treatment of pericolic or pelvic abscesses can initially be treated with antibiotic therapy or combined with percutaneous drainage. If this treatment fails, surgical drainage is required. Patients with a perforated ACD resulting in peritonitis should undergo an emergency operation. There is an ongoing debate about the optimal surgical strategy.
CONCLUSION
Scientific evidence is scarce for some aspects of ACD treatment (e.g. natural history of ACD, ACD in special patient groups, prevention of ACD, treatment of uncomplicated ACD and medical treatment of recurrent ACD), leading to treatment being guided by the surgeon's personal preference. Other aspects of the management of patients with ACD have been more thoroughly researched (e.g. imaging techniques, treatment of complicated ACD and elective surgery of ACD). This guideline of the diagnostics and treatment of ACD can be used as a reference for clinicians who treat patients with ACD.

BACKGROUND
Symptomatic diverticular disease is challenging for patients, clinicians and health services. The prevalence increases with age and BMI and as such, the burden of this disease is set to increase with higher rates of acute presentations already documented. The natural history of recurrent episodes, complications and symptom progression is not fully understood. Furthermore, medical and surgical management strategies are under constant appraisal, debate and evolution.
METHODS
A review of the contemporary literature was performed to examine the emerging trend towards conservative treatment.
RESULTS
Routine use of in-patient, intravenous antibiotics may not be required and outpatient management is possible for certain patients. Universal colonoscopy examination after uncomplicated acute diverticulitis is controversial but is mandatory after complicated episodes. Recent, high-profile, clinical trials suggest that less aggressive surgical management of both acute and chronic presentations may be feasible in some cases.
CONCLUSIONS
Diverticulitis is a common yet challenging topic that demands clinicians to provide an individualised yet evidence-based approach.

INTRODUCTION
Acute appendiceal diverticulitis is an unusual cause of acute abdomen, considered clinically indistinguishable from acute appendicitis.
MATERIAL AND METHODS
In a historic cohort study with 27 cases of appendiceal diverticulitis and 54 cases of acute appendicitis, we compared clinical characteristics, diagnostic tests and pathology findings of the two processes.
RESULTS
Mean age at presentation was lower in acute appendicitis (37.24 +/- 19.98 vs. 54.81 +/- 17.55 years, p < 0.001), with significant differences between men (33.33 +/- 15.89 vs. 57 +/- 18.02 years, p < 0.001) but not between women (41.76 +/- 24.87 vs. 50.44 +/- 16.69 years, p = 0.34). In the diverticulitis group, 48.15 % had leukocytosis vs. 81.48 % in the appendicitis group (p = 0.02); there was no difference in leukocyte count (13770.37 +/- 4382.55 vs. 14279.63 +/- 4268.59, p = 0.61). Patients with appendiceal diverticulitis had a higher incidence of appendiceal mucocele (p = 0.01) and a lower proportion of appendiceal gangrene (p = 0.03). There were no differences in appendiceal perforation or ulceration. Symptom duration before emergency department attendance (71.61 +/- 85.25 hours vs. 36.84 +/- 33.59 hours; Z = -3.1 p = 0.002), duration of surgery (85 +/- 40 minutes vs. 60 +/- 21 minutes, Z = -3.2, p = 0.001) and the presence of appendicular plastron was higher in patients with diverticulitis vs. appendicitis (8 vs. 5 patients [p = 0.01, Odds ratio 2.2]).
CONCLUSIONS
Appendiceal diverticulitis presents a series of clinical, epidemiological and pathological differences with respect to acute appendicitis. The former shows a more indolent course with delayed diagnosis.
